BAL 2025: 28 Countries Kick Off in Morocco


A record 28 countries and 156 players will compete in the 2025 Basketball Africa League, which will kick off this Saturday, April 5, at the Prince Moulay Abdellah Sports Complex in Rabat, Morocco.

In the season opener, Stade Malien (Mali), third-placed in 2023, will face Rivers Hoopers (Nigeria), third-placed in 2024, at 16:00 p.m. GMT. In the second game, the home team, Fath Union Sport (FUS; Morocco), will face Al Ittihad (Egypt), debuting in this competition, at 19:00 p.m. GMT. The 2025 BAL season will reach fans in 214 countries and territories in 17 languages through free-to-air and pay-TV broadcast partnerships with the African Broadcasting Union, American Forces Network (AFN), Canal+, ESPN, FIBA's digital platform, Courtside 189, NBA TV, Tencent Sports, TV5 Monde and live streaming on Application of BAL, at BAL website and BAL YouTube channel.

The BAL also announced today that the league will honor NBA legend Dikembe Mutombo throughout the season, including a “DM55” patch on all player jerseys and select warm-up gear, as well as during the minutes of silence before each conference group stage.

Dikembe Mutombo is a four-time NBA Defensive Player of the Year, a member of the Naismith Basketball Hall of Fame, and the NBA's first global ambassador after his retirement in 2009.

During the 2025 BAL season, each four-team conference will play a 12-game group stage, during which each team will face the remaining three teams in its conference twice. During the group stage, all teams will play on every game day.

The Kalahari Conference group stage will take place from April 5 to 13 in Rabat. The Sahara Conference group stage will take place from Saturday, April 26, to Sunday, May 4, at the Dakar Arena in Dakar. The Nile Conference group stage will take place from Saturday, May 17, to Sunday, May 25, at the BK Arena in Kigali, Rwanda.

Eight teams from the three conferences will travel to Pretoria, South Africa, for four qualifying games, followed by eight playoff games and single-elimination finals, from Friday, June 6, to Saturday, June 14.
